嘿那裡!您是否曾經在為網站或專案優化圖像而苦苦掙扎,我有一些令人興奮的東西:照片壓縮器。它是一個命令列工具,旨在無縫壓縮映像並將其轉換為超輕 .webp 格式。
工具由 Sharp 提供支持,這使其快速可靠。它可以幫助您像專業人士一樣優化媒體。無論您是使用本機檔案還是雲端託管圖像,照片壓縮器都會為您提供支援。
這就是您會喜歡它的原因:
最佳化本地圖片:輕鬆壓縮本機目錄中的圖片。
優化雲圖像:直接從 URL 甚至圖像 URL 目錄處理圖像。
沒有命名頭痛:它會自動為您處理檔案名稱衝突。
詳細日誌:了解節省和處理時間的見解。
安裝照片壓縮器輕而易舉。選擇您最喜歡的套件管理器:
npm install -g photo-compressor
或者,如果您是 Yarn 粉絲:
yarn global add photo-compressor
不想全域安裝任何東西?沒問題!直接使用 npx 運行它:
npx photo-compressor
使用照片壓縮器很簡單。這是其命令和選項的概要。
-h, --help: 顯示幫助資訊。
-V, --version:檢查軟體包的當前版本。
輕鬆壓縮本地目錄中的影像:
photo-compressor local --dir <path_to_directory> --output <path_to_output_directory>
選項:
-d, --dir
-o, --output
您有線上寄存的圖片嗎?像這樣壓縮它們:
photo-compressor cloud --url <image_url_OR_array_of_images> --output <path_to_output_directory>
選項:
-u, --url
-o, --output
以下是一些幫助您入門的實際範例:
npm install -g photo-compressor
yarn global add photo-compressor
我為什麼要創建這個工具?老實說,我在狂看矽谷並受到啟發,建立了一些與壓縮相關的東西。事實證明,對於需要快速優化影像以獲得更好的 Web 效能的 Web 開發人員來說,這是一個巧妙的解決方案。 (P.S.我還是個菜鳥,所以隨時歡迎回饋!)
開發社群就是協作。如果您有改進此工具的想法或發現任何錯誤,請前往我們的 GitHub 儲存庫並做出貢獻!
快樂編碼!請在評論中告訴我您對該包的看法。
以上是我創建了一個照片壓縮器 CLI 工具的詳細內容。更多資訊請關注PHP中文網其他相關文章!